In 2025, MeDMUN joined with seven other high school Model UN organizations to established the Coalition of Michigan Model United Nations (COMMUN). The goal of COMMUN is to act as a coordinating body and forum for the region's MUN Conference organizers.
COMMUN seeks to address the lack of coordination between MUN Conferences in Michigan and Toledo by creating a one-stop shop for MUN in the region and serving as a regular forum for the conference organizations to discuss conference best practices and deconflict between the organizations. COMMUN will clearly lay out the conference schedule for all participating conference organizations to allow for teams to more effectively plan their season. COMMUN will also develop and maintain training resources for advisers, students, and parents who have an MUN team or are interested in starting one.
COMMUN also endeavors to make the region's MUN community more resilient by helping lower the barriers to participate in MUN Conferences and increasing the number of MUN teams. COMMUN seeks to address funding challenges that hampers attendance at MUN Conferences as well as seeks to identify and communicate process, procedures, and policy differences between the various MUN conferences. COMMUN does not work to erode what makes each MUN Conference unique, but tries to effectively communicate the differences so that advisers, students, and parents can make an informed decision for their team and to lower the barriers to participate in MUN at each conference.

The founding COMMUN members are:
- The Black Swamp Security Councils (BSSC)
- The Great Lakes Invitational Conference Association (GLICA)
- The Metro Detroit Model United Nations Organization (MeDMUN)
- The Michigan State University Model United Nations (MSUMUN)
- The Model United Nations of the University of Michigan (MUNUM)
- Oakland University Model United Nations (OUMUN)
- The Southeast Michigan Model United Nations Association (SEMMUNA)
- SuperMUN
